ICE 5 private yacht

The luxury motor yacht ICE 5 is a private yacht and is not available to charter.

ICE 5, previously named CAPRICORN, was built by Turquoise and delivered to her owner in 2002, she later underwent a refit in 2017.

ICE 5 can accommodate 12 guests in 6 cabins consisting of a primary suite with a king size bed and en-suite bathroom facilities located on the deck, a VIP suite with a king size bed and en-suite bathroom facilities, 3 cabins with a queen size bed and en-suite bathroom facilities and a cabin with 2 single beds and en-suite bathroom facilities.

Amenities on board include Air Conditioning, Exercise equipment, Light fishing gear, Gym, Jacuzzi on deck, Stabilizers At Anchor and Wi-Fi.

Ben Schmidt

Captain
Ben Schmidt

Ben originally hails from a small coastal town in South Australia where the ocean is an integral part of life. It was there his affection
for the sea began, through surfing and sailing. For the past 18 years, Ben has worked his way through the ranks. He has served
on both private and charter vessels completing many hundreds of thousands of nautical miles all over the globe. This includes
but is not limited to 5 transits of the Panama Canal, 8 Atlantic crossings and multiple Mediterranean and Caribbean seasons.
Ben completed his Master 3000 gt in 2013. Over the last 9 years as captain he has successfully navigated through the Med,
Caribbean, Bahamas and USA East Coast. He brings a wealth of knowledge and experience along with a joke or two to make your
stay a safe and unforgettable one.
